About L J Stevens Intermediate School

L J Stevens Intermediate School serves 363 students in grades 2 through 5 in Wilmington, Illinois. With 23 full-time equivalent teachers, the school maintains a student-teacher ratio of 15.8:1, providing reasonable class sizes for elementary learners. The school demonstrates solid academic performance, earning a MySchoolScout rating of 7.0 out of 10 and ranking in the 76th percentile statewide at #905 out of 3,819 Illinois elementary schools.

With an academic score of 8.6 out of 10, L J Stevens shows particular strength in its overall educational approach. In English Language Arts and reading assessments, 47% of students perform at proficient or above levels across the grade span. The school draws from a stable community where the median household income is $73,223 and median home values reach $205,800.

The surrounding ZIP code area has a population of 11,303 residents, with 16% holding bachelor's degrees or higher and a modest poverty rate of 9.0%. These demographics reflect a working-class community with steady economic foundations. L J Stevens Intermediate School is situated in Wilmington, a town positioned on the fringe of an urban area in Will County, offering students access to both small-town community feel and proximity to broader metropolitan opportunities.

Community Profile

The community surrounding L J Stevens Intermediate School has a median household income of $76,398. It is a community where 17%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$224,800, with a median rent of $975/month. The area has a poverty rate of 10.5%. The average commute for residents is 28 minutes.
